WebMay 20, 2024 · The Right Course is a one-stop-shop containing information about available courses if you want to learn new skills, update your skills or find a new direction.; … WebIf you take up a job while on a course, Springboard+ will fund the fees for the full academic year. If your course extends into another academic year(s) the amount of fees payable will be a matter for your college to decide. Employed people. If you are employed, you must pay a 10% contribution towards the course fee at level 7, 8 and 9 on the NFQ. WebMar 2, 2024 · If you’re going to university in Northern Ireland. Universities can charge you up to £4,710 a year for undergraduate tuition. You can apply to Student Finance NI for a loan of up to £4,710 to help cover this fee. If you wish to study at a private institution, where fees may be higher, you’ll need to pay the excess yourself.
